Matthew 7:3-5 3"Why do you look at the speck of sawdust in your brother's eye and pay no attention to the plank in your own eye? 4How can you say to your brother, 'Let me take the speck out of your eye,' when all the time there is a plank in your own eye? 5You hypocrite, first take the plank out of your own eye, and then you will see clearly to remove the speck from your brother's eye.
If "Christians" worried about their own sins & not everybody elses I truly believe that we would see more people running to the church, not from the church. What would be your motives in "calling out" somebody's sins who isn't saved... Here are four questions to help you figure that out...
-Do I want to catch them?
-Am I trying to control them?
-Am I trying to crush them?
-Do I want to cover them?
I would say if you answered yes to any of these questions you probably are doing it to make yourself feel better because of an insecurity. I would reccomend you read THIS!!! Our motives should never be to catch somebody, control anybody, crush them, or to be a cover for them. We should always point them to Jesus!
